My Thirteen Favorite Peace Quotes

 

 

  1. There was never a good war or a bad peace. Benjamin Franklin
  2. You can’t shake hands with a clenched fist. Gandhi
  3. When the power of love overcomes the love of power the world will know peace. Jimi Hendrix
  4. All we are saying is give peace a chance. John Lennon
  5. Nothing can bring you peace but yourself. Ralph Waldo Emerson
  6. You can’t separate peace from freedom because no one can be at peace unless he has freedom. Malcolm X
  7. If you want to make peace, you don’t talk to your friends. You talk to your enemies. Moshe Dayan
  8. Let no one ever come to you without leaving feeling happier and better. Mother Teresa
  9. For it isn’t enough to talk about peace. One must believe in it. And it isn’t enough to believe in it. One must work at it. Eleanor Roosevelt
  10. Peace is not God’s gift to his creatures. It is our gift to each other. Elie Wiesel
  11. Hope is a waking dream. Aristotle
  12. How wonderful is it that no one need wait a single moment before starting to improve the world. Anne Frank
